Healthy and fast egg roll in a bowl with pork, cabbage, and Asian sauce, all made in one skillet.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ings: 4
Course: Dinner, Lunch, Main Course
Cuisine: Asian-Inspired, Chinese-American, Low Carb
Calories: 380

Ingredients
  

  • 1 lb Ground pork - Or turkey beef, or chicken
  • 4 cups Shredded cabbage - Or coleslaw mix
  • 1 cup Shredded carrots - Or matchstick carrots
  • 3 cloves Garlic - Minced
  • 1 tablespoon Fresh ginger - Grated
  • 4 Green onions - Sliced white and green parts split
  • 1 tablespoon Sesame oil - For flavor
  • 1 tablespoon Vegetable oil - For cooking
  • 3 tablespoon Soy sauce - Or tamari/coconut aminos
  • 1 tablespoon Rice v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on Sriracha - Or chili garlic sauce
  • 1 tablespoon Sesame seeds - For garnish
  • Black pepper - To taste
  • ¼ cup Chicken broth - Optional helps soften cabbage
  • Optional add-ins - Mushrooms water chestnuts, sprouts

Equipment

  • 1 Large skillet (12-inch or larger, nonstick preferred)
  • 1 Wooden Spoon (Or spatula for stirring)
  • 1 Sharp knife (For prepping garlic, ginger, and veg)
  • 1 Cutting board
  • 1 Mixing bowl (For whisking sauce ingredients)

Method
 

  1.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add ground pork and cook 5–7 minutes, breaking it apart, until no pink remains.

  2. Push meat to the sides. Add sesame oil in the center, then sauté minced garlic and grated ginger for 30 seconds. Stir to combine.

  3. Add shredded cabbage and carrots. Cook 5–7 minutes, stirring occasionally, until vegetables are tender but slightly crisp.

  4. Whisk soy sauce, rice vinegar, and sriracha. Pour into pan and toss to coat everything evenly. Let cook 2–3 more minutes.

  5. Remove from heat. Stir in green onions and sprinkle sesame seeds on top. Serve as is, or over rice/cauliflower rice.
